Align and position shapes

Align your shapes in straight lines with even spacing to give your diagram a polished look.

Position shapes manually

  1. Add a shape on the drawing page.

  2. Drag a second shape onto the drawing page, and position it near the first one.

    Alignment guides show how the two shapes align to each other.

  3. Continue to add shapes and check the alignment guides for even spacing.

Align and space shapes automatically

  1. Select the shapes you want to align.

    To align all the shapes on the drawing page, select a blank area of the page.

  2. Select Home > Position > Auto Align & Space.

Align shapes without changing the spacing

  1. Select the shape that the other shape will align to.

  2. Select the other shapes.

  3. Select Home > Align.

  4. Select an alignment option to preview the effect.

  5. Select an alignment that works for your diagram.

Set an equal distance between shapes

  1. Select the shapes you want to space.

  2. Select Home > Position > Spacing Options.

  3. Type in the distance between shapes.

  4. Select OK.
